Every November, the megacity of Shanghai turns into a global hub of innovation and commerce thanks to the China International Import Expo (CIIE) 🌟. Launched in 2018, this expo is the world's first national event dedicated solely to imports, making it both a magnet and a gateway for opportunities on the global stage.
In 2023, CIIE welcomes over 4,100 companies from 155 countries and regions, unveiling 461 brand-new products, technologies, and services. From cutting-edge healthcare solutions by Johnson & Johnson to American agricultural delights showcased at the US Pavilion, deals worth hundreds of millions have been sealed, proving that participation here can pay off big time 💰.
Beyond the exhibition halls, CIIE reflects the Chinese mainland's high-level opening-up. Since the launch of the Chinese mainland's 14th Five-Year Plan (2021–2025), the mainland has absorbed more than $700 billion in foreign direct investment, while 25,000 new overseas-funded enterprises have sprung up, reinforcing the Chinese mainland's role as a top destination for global investors.
